A set of complex numbers is specified. Determine all the boundary points and whether the set is open, closed, open and closed, or not open and not closed. Specify all boundary points of the set (whether or not they belong to the set). V is the set of all z with 2<Re(z)32<\operatorname{Re}(z) \leq 3 and -1 < Imz < 1.

Consider the sketch below.

The set VV is the rectangle with vertices at 2+i2+i, 2i2-i, 3+i3+i and 3i3-i. It is the intersection of the horizontal band (marked red) that contains all numbers whose imaginary part is between 1-1 and 1 and the vertical band (marked blue) that contains all numbers whose real part is between 2 and 3.
